JAMES EASTON

HOME PORTFOLIO CV PROJECTS CONTACT

JAMES EASTON

Unity
C#
C++
Interop
PS4

Little Nightmares II - Deluxe Edition (PS4 Bonus Content)

Little Nightmares II is a suspense-adventure game in which you play as Mono, a young boy trapped in a world that has been distorted by the humming transmission of a distant tower...

With Six, the girl in a yellow raincoat, as his guide, Mono sets out to discover the dark secrets of The Signal Tower and save Six from her terrible fate. But their journey will not be straightforward as Mono and Six will face a gallery of new threats from the terrible residents of this world. Will you dare to face this collection of new, little nightmares?



My Work On This Project

While working for Huey Games, I was tasked with the creation of three pieces of extra content to be bundled with the PlayStation 4 edition of "Little Nightmares II". This process was not without its challenges however, I overcame them all and created three pieces of content that satisfied our client.


Digital Art Book App

This app allows the user to literally flick through pages of a digital art book by simply swiping their finger across the DualShock 4 controller's touch pad. With each page, the LED on the controller changes colour to the average colour of the image on the screen. Images can be selected and zoomed in on for a closer look. The main focus of development for this app was the functionality to export a PDF version of the art book to a USB storage device directly from the PlayStation 4 system. Adding this functionality required the development of a proprietary DLL that uses existing Sony libraries. This library was written in C++ and is interfaced with C#. The managed code is capable of interfacing with unmanaged code via a messaging system.


Digital Soundtrack App

The digital soundtrack player app features music from the "Little Nightmares II - Official Soundtrack". Each track has a unique background which the app will elegantly fade to when that track starts playing. As with the digital art book app, the entire soundtrack can be exported to a USB storage device.


PlayStation 4 Dynamic Theme

The "Little Nightmares II" dynamic theme features a parallax zooming effect when moving between the function and content areas on the PlayStation 4 system dashboard, along with a looping animation of the main character and dynamic animations on numerous elements in the scene.